Subject: Cut-over complete — Tillverse FX rounding fix

The cut-over to the new conversion path is done. Rounding now happens once, at settlement, using banker's rounding; the intermediate truncation that caused the drift is gone. No discrepancies in the reconciliation run. For review, the conversion service now runs with the following settings.

config for tagep-yajef:
ulawyn:
  log_level: error
  metrics_host: metrics.ulawyn.lumiclabs.internal
  pin: 0564
  pool_size: 32

**Key Ceremony Checklist — Item 7: Firmware Channel Signing (Larkspur Devices)**

Before signing the quarterly firmware manifest for the Tallowmere update channel, confirm both witnesses are present and the air-gapped laptop shows the correct channel fingerprint on screen. New team members: never skip the fingerprint read-back, even if rushed. Once the manifest is signed and the session log is countersigned, record the recovery passphrase exactly as follows.

strongbox words: zorwyn-sorael-belion-ulaius-silmir-ulays-briax-rusdor-gorix

Handover notes on the replica-lag alarm for the Quillbase reporting cluster. The alarm fires whenever the Ostrava replica falls more than the configured threshold behind primary, which happens nightly during the bulk export from Ledgerline. I've confirmed the lag is benign — the export saturates write throughput — but we should not simply raise thresholds without review. For context, the alarm currently evaluates against these configured values.

deployment values, kajep-kageg:
[praix]
host = praix.paliqcorp.corp
user = praix_svc
database = praix_prod

## On-call Notes: Cold Starts on Larkspindle Handlers

The Larkspindle checkout handlers run on our Quillfog serverless runtime, and cold starts there routinely exceed four seconds because the handler pulls its pricing snapshot at init. If p99 latency alerts fire after a deploy, check whether the pre-warmer pool drained; redeploys reset it to zero. You can trigger a manual warm cycle via the internal Warmline service, which pre-invokes each handler twice per region. Warmline requests must be authenticated, so include the key shown below.

service key, fawip-bajef: kto11_Qt5wZK9vdNC